Across TCGA patient cohorts, PRPF39 RNA expression is significantly associated with the protein abundance of many other proteins, with 17,063 significant associations in total. LSCC shows the largest number of these associations.

The most reproducible PRPF39-associated proteins across cancer lineages are FKBP3, MTA1, and SUPT16H. Each is linked with PRPF39 in more than 7 cancer types. Because this analysis shows association rather than direction, both PRPF39-to-partner and partner-to-PRPF39 results are reported.
